Situated on the edge of the sought-after village of Grundisburgh, a short distance from Woodbridge is this extended detached family home, occupying a generous plot and with a double garage.

Poplar Cottage is a three bedroom detached family home situated on the edge of the sought-after village of Grundisburgh which lies approximately 8 miles of Woodbridge.

The property has been beautifully extended to provide generous accommodation including a sitting room with separate dining room, kitchen/breakfast room and conservatory overlooking the garden. Along with parking for numerous cars there is a detached double garage.

The accommodation comprises a reception hall with tiled floor, stairs to the first floor and doors off. To the front is a boot room which could be used as a study with a built-in cupboard. To the rear of the property is the good size 17' sitting room which has a feature wood burner, double doors opening into the conservatory and door to the dining room. The conservatory overlooks the rear garden and has bi-fold doors opening onto a decking area.

The dining room also has double doors onto the garden and an opening through to the kitchen/breakfast room which has an extensive range of base and eye level units, work surfaces, sink, built-in double oven and hob with extractor over. A door leads through to the utility room which has access to the garden and door to a cloakroom with WC and basin. The utility has further base level units, work surfaces, sink and space for a dishwasher, washing machine and tumble dryer.

The first floor galleried landing could also be used as a handy study area and has doors off to three double bedrooms, all of which overlook the rear garden and the family bathroom. The main bedroom has a dual aspect and door leading into a spacious en-suite with contemporary suite comprising a shower, WC and basin with built-in cupboards/storage. The family bathroom also has a white suite of shower, basin, WC and freestanding roll top bath.

Outside
The front garden has post and rail fencing and a shingle driveway providing parking for numerous cars. There is a vehicular right of way across the entrance to the driveway to allow access to the paddock adjacent to the property. The remainder of the garden is laid to lawn and has various shrubs and borders. There is a detached double garage with twin doors and side access.

The rear garden is predominantly laid to lawn and is of generous proportions, it is enclosed by mature high level hedging and shrubs. To the immediate rear of the property is a patio and decking area.


Location

Grundisburgh is a popular village to the North East of Ipswich and North West of Woodbridge, and benefits from a good community feel with regular monthly events. There is a good local primary school, as well as a doctors surgery, post office, two local shops and a popular public house which the vendor advises serves excellent cuisine.

The historic market town of Woodbridge is within easy reach and offers numerous boutique shops, restaurants and a railway station which provides links to Ipswich, which is on the mainline rail service to London Liverpool Street. Woodbridge, being situated on the River Deben, offers sailing facilities with its own yacht club and for the golfing enthusiast there is Woodbridge golf course just a short drive away.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on June 4,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
